Seawater Ice Maker "Nano Ice"

High freshness distribution and long-term freshness preservation! Ultra-fine crystal ice manufacturing machine.

"Nano Ice" is a machine that produces ultra-fine crystal ice of 0.4μm, which could not be achieved with conventional ice-making technology. Since it is ultra-fine particle ice, it melts easily and rapidly cools the target object, preventing freshness decline due to heat. Additionally, it can preserve fresh products without damaging them, maintaining the freshness of fresh goods that could not be stored for long periods before. Manufacturing of industrial ice makers, snow machines, and 0°C water chillers.

ICEMAN Corporation: True to its name, a passionate company that thrives on ice, snow, and water.

There are very few companies in the world that manufacture ice-making machines, but our products can create ice not only from tap water but also from saltwater and various aqueous solutions. Furthermore, we have developed a snow-making machine that can produce "natural snow" derived from ice, which is already in practical use. We continue to engage in unique development in response to diverse requests from users, and we are currently nearing completion of a marine seawater ice-making machine. This addresses the needs expressed in the field, where "fishing boats must load ice before departing and return before it melts." If there is a shortage of ice, the value of the catch decreases, which has been considered an "inevitable situation" worldwide. Marine ice-making machines do not exist anywhere in the world, and our company has faced many challenges. The source water is seawater, operations are conducted on a swaying ship, there are issues with water spillage, and there is a lack of small seawater refrigeration units and compatible generators. It has truly been a situation of lacking everything, but through careful consideration and repeated problem-solving, completion is now imminent.
